Longton unfurls itself across the gentle undulations of southeastern Kansas, a place where the horizon seems to stretch into infinity. It lies 43.9 miles north of Bartlesville, OK (from Bartlesville, OK: bearing 353°T), and is situated 17.6 miles south-west of Fredonia. The history of Longton is deeply intertwined with the agricultural pulse of Elk County, its economy long anchored by the cultivation of grain and the raising of livestock that graze on the surrounding pastures. This is a land that has known the steady, determined work of generations, each one contributing to the enduring rhythm of rural life. For a time, the discovery of oil brought a brief, feverish surge of activity, a fleeting shimmer of prosperity that left its mark on the local character, a memory of boom and bust that adds a layer of stoic pragmatism to the community.
